A delayed 400 GeV photon from GRB 221009A and implication on the intergalactic magnetic field

Z. Xia, Y. Wang, et al.

The Large High Altitude Air Shower Observatory (LHAASO) made a groundbreaking detection of 0.2–13 TeV emissions from GRB 221009A shortly after the trigger. Notably, the Fermi Large Area Telescope followed suit with the discovery of a delayed 400 GeV photon. This exciting research by Zi-Qing Xia, Yun Wang, Qiang Yuan, and Yi-Zhong Fan delves into the implications of this cascade emission and its probabilities, providing new insights into high-energy astrophysical phenomena.
